    Original text: The Cry of the Bees

    One day, an 11-year-old girl came to the apiary to play and found many bees gathered on the hive, their wings not flapping, but still buzzing. She remembered the principle of bee vocalization in "100,000 Whys": the buzzing of bees comes from the vibration of their wings, up to 200 times per second, and if the wings stop vibrating, the sound also stops.

    But now the bee's wings are not vibrating, but they are still buzzing. What exactly is this sound coming from? She went to ask the teacher, who thought that what the book said was not wrong.

    So, she decided to find out for herself. She glued the wings of the bees to the wooden board, and the bees still made sounds. She simply used scissors to cut off its wings, and the bees were still buzzing.

    In this way, the two methods were alternated 42 times, using 48 bees each time, and the results were very different from the conclusions in the book. In order to find out the secret of the bee's vocalization, she glued the bee to the wooden board, searched it carefully with a magnifying glass, and observed it for a month, and finally found two small black dots smaller than rape seeds at the base of the bee's wings. When the bee makes a sound, the small black dots agitate up and down; She pierced the little black dot with a pin, and the bee stopped making a sound.

    She found some bees, and without damaging their wings, she only pierced the small black dots, and the bees flew around without making a ......soundA year later, the 11-year-old girl wrote a scientific essay "Bees Don't Make Sounds by Wing Vibrating", and won the Silver Award for Outstanding Projects and the Coats Science Popularization Special Award at the 18th National Youth Science and Technology Innovation Competition. She is Nie Li, a fifth-grade student at the Central Primary School in Huangxiekou Town, Jianli County, Hubei Province.

    The text bee is from the work "Insects", "Bee" is an article written by Fabre, a famous French entomologist and scientist, known as "the Homer of the Sitankunchailu Insect World" and "Virgil of the Insect World", which is deeply appreciated and loved by the Suizi Provençal poet Mistral.

    Insects, also known as "The World of Insects", "Insect Story", "Entomological Notes" or "The Story of Insects", is a long biological work written by the French entomologist and writer Jean-Henri Casimir Fabre, with a total of ten volumes.

    "The Bees" is an essay written by Fabre from his work "Insects", and the article writes in the first person about an experiment he has done, that is, to confirm whether bees have the ability to identify directions, reflecting the author's rigorous scientific attitude and realistic style.

    The description of the text reflects the author's rigorous scientific style. The author's rigorous style is reflected in the fact that at the beginning of the text, the author uses the word "listening".

    What I have heard is not necessarily true and reliable, so this has not only become the reason for "I" to conduct experiments, but also reflects "I" do not believe in blindly following the scientific attitude of seeking truth.
